Multifunctional magnetic nanoparticles for orthopedic and biofilm infections

Multifunctional magnetic nanoparticles for orthopedic and biofilm infections

Bone related infectious diseases (including osteomyelitis and prosthesis infection) are of great concern to the medical world. These types of deep tissue infections involve biofilms and are frequently chronic and always painful. Biofilms are infections whereby bacteria form a robust colony protected by a sticky slime matrix from ...
